Uz
Overview
- Type: Region
- Testament: Old
- Modern Location: Uncertain; often associated with Edom, Aram, or north Arabia
Biblical Significance
Uz is the land where Job lived. Its uncertain location contributes to the book’s universal feel: Job is not framed through Israel’s national institutions but as a righteous sufferer before God.

Notes
The setting outside explicit Israelite institutions helps Job address suffering as a human and theological question before it is a national one.
